
Loëlle Monsanto
Loëlle Monsanto is a Surinamese filmmaker known for her dedication to telling stories that reflect her culture and heritage. Her latest film, 'Fort Buku', showcases the adventures of three friends uncovering the mysteries surrounding the legendary freedom fighters of Suriname. With a background in folklore and a passion for storytelling, Monsanto aims to inspire future generations through her work, emphasizing the importance of preserving untold Surinamese stories for cultural heritage.
